IBD - Java Engineer - Associate - London
- Employer
- Goldman Sachs
- Location
- London, United Kingdom
- Salary
- Competitive
- Closing date
- Jun 16, 2022
View more
- Job Function
- Other
- Industry Sector
- Finance - General
- Employment Type
- Full Time
- Education
- Bachelors
You need to sign in or create an account to save a job.
JOB DUTIES:
MINIMUM YEARS EXPERIENCE REQUIRED:
Four (4) years' experience in the job offered or in a related position. Master's or Bachelor's degree
SPECIAL SKILLS AND/OR LICENSES REQUIRED TO PERFORM THE JOB:
Must have at least four (4) years of experience in the Java ecosystem:
ABOUT GOLDMAN SACHS
At Goldman Sachs, we commit our people, capital and ideas to help our clients, shareholders and the communities we serve to grow. Founded in 1869, we are a leading global investment banking, securities and investment management firm. Headquartered in New York, we maintain offices around the world.
We believe who you are makes you better at what you do. We're committed to fostering and advancing diversity and inclusion in our own workplace and beyond by ensuring every individual within our firm has a number of opportunities to grow professionally and personally, from our training and development opportunities and firmwide networks to benefits, wellness and personal finance offerings and mindfulness programs. Learn more about our culture, benefits, and people at GS.com/careers .
We're committed to finding reasonable accommodations for candidates with special needs or disabilities during our recruiting process. Learn more: https:// www.goldmansachs.com/careers/footer/disability-statement.html
© The Goldman Sachs Group, Inc., 2021. All rights reserved.
Goldman Sachs is an equal employment/affirmative action employer Female/Minority/Disability/Veteran/Sexual Orientation/Gender Identity
- Engage in building new and maintaining existing enterprise applications and platforms used by Investment Bankers globally by using various frontend (such as JavaScript, HTML CSS), backend (such as Java, Spring, Hibernate) and database (such as SQL Server, ElasticSearch) technologies.
- Involved in all phases of software development life cycle (SDLC) including effort estimation, the gathering of business requirements, the design, development, reviewing, building, testing, and deployment of commercial scale software changes.
- Interface and communicate independently with Investment Bankers for requirement discussions, user acceptance testing, production pilot and support.
- Involved in technical design and development for both business-driven and infrastructure projects with minimal supervision.
- Apply Agile methodologies in sprint-based development.
- Involved in periodic release by getting involved in deployment and post release check-outs.
- Engage with support teams to troubleshoot and solve production issue faced by Investment Bankers.
- Analyze new tools and technologies for proof of concept and come up with recommendation.
- Demonstrate leadership and decision making to help train and mentor new application developers.
MINIMUM YEARS EXPERIENCE REQUIRED:
Four (4) years' experience in the job offered or in a related position. Master's or Bachelor's degree
SPECIAL SKILLS AND/OR LICENSES REQUIRED TO PERFORM THE JOB:
Must have at least four (4) years of experience in the Java ecosystem:
- Utilizing programming skills to analyze, design, develop, and support enterprise application development.
- Utilizing scalable enterprise system design and micro services architecture.
- Utilizing object-oriented concepts, data structures and design patterns.
- Programing experience in the following technologies:
- Java/J2EE, Spring, Hibernate
- UI Technologies including React, Angular, Node JS, HTML, JavaScript, and CSS
- Messaging Technologies including Kafka, Rabbit MQ
- Open-source frameworks and APIs including Dropwizard, Apache Drools, Log4J, MapStruct, Dozer, and Mockito
- Database technologies including Sybase and MongoDB
- Business process model and notation (BPMN) tools such as Camunda.
- Source control management systems e.g. Git, build systems including Maven and Gradle, Code quality including Semmle, Artifact repository manager including Maven, Continuous integration including Jenkins, and Project tracking including JIRA.
- Testing driven development using TestNG, Jasmine, Karma, and Jest, also applying knowledge of test practices and different types of testing to build reliable and resilient applications.
- Providing level three support for applications using troubleshooting skills.
ABOUT GOLDMAN SACHS
At Goldman Sachs, we commit our people, capital and ideas to help our clients, shareholders and the communities we serve to grow. Founded in 1869, we are a leading global investment banking, securities and investment management firm. Headquartered in New York, we maintain offices around the world.
We believe who you are makes you better at what you do. We're committed to fostering and advancing diversity and inclusion in our own workplace and beyond by ensuring every individual within our firm has a number of opportunities to grow professionally and personally, from our training and development opportunities and firmwide networks to benefits, wellness and personal finance offerings and mindfulness programs. Learn more about our culture, benefits, and people at GS.com/careers .
We're committed to finding reasonable accommodations for candidates with special needs or disabilities during our recruiting process. Learn more: https:// www.goldmansachs.com/careers/footer/disability-statement.html
© The Goldman Sachs Group, Inc., 2021. All rights reserved.
Goldman Sachs is an equal employment/affirmative action employer Female/Minority/Disability/Veteran/Sexual Orientation/Gender Identity
You need to sign in or create an account to save a job.
Sign in to create job alerts
Sign in or create an account to start creating job alerts and receive personalised job recommendations straight to your inbox.
Create alert